A Patient Relations Specialist is responsible for maintaining positive relationships between healthcare providers and patients. Their primary role is to ensure patient satisfaction by addressing any concerns or issues that may arise during their healthcare journey. This includes actively listening to patients, providing empathetic support, and resolving conflicts in a timely manner. Patient Relations Specialists serve as a liaison between patients and healthcare staff, advocating for patients' rights and facilitating effective communication. They also play a crucial role in educating patients about their rights, responsibilities, and available resources. Additionally, they may conduct patient surveys, analyze feedback, and implement improvement strategies to enhance patient experience. This occupation requires excellent interpersonal and communication skills, strong problem-solving abilities, and a deep understanding of healthcare regulations and policies.

Patient Relations Specialist salary in Iraq
Average Yearly Salary of Patient Relations Specialist in Iraq is approximately 5,503,159 IQD (3,734 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 8,160,000 IQD (6,000 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Patient Relations Specialist job salary compared to average salary in Iraq.
Comparison shows that a person working as Patient Relations Specialist in Iraq earns on average:
0.67 times the average salary (or 67% of average salary).
